Be Prepared for Strongest Meteor Storm in a Decade


Satellites like the Hubble Space Telescope and International Space Station face the threat of a meteor storm which is expected to be the strongest in a decade.

This Month, Red Mars and Blue Regulus

The night sky in the month of June will be a beautiful sight for astronomers, as well as ordinary citizens. The red planet Mars, and the blue star Regulus in the position closest this month will appear as a double star that shines brightly in the western sky.
